Played out like I thought it would. Sport specificity and the training that goes with it. Mean Ronaldo probably has barely ever touched a starting block to where sprinters spend a great amount of time on form in the blocks to insure as much energy as possible is transferred into a efficient start.

I would predict the players that would react most like soccer players from football would be defensive backs. They do alot of side to side and forward back movement with sudden changes of speed and when in man to man coverage are not use to doing predetermined patterns (like a wide receiver would). Second on my list would be tailbacks.
